Transaction 608ead6caa99839aced366a83391a5dafcfe76d1a48140a6d17ae2c3b77fda17

2 Input
1 Outputs
  • 608ead6caa99839aced366a83391a5dafcfe76d1a48140a6d17ae2c3b77fda17:0
  • value  700000043
    address  1ATH8X9JkVGJvcxeT9ADJGAcd5ZSiWfYw1